public ActionResult DeleteConfirmed(int id) { ControleAcompanhamento controleAcompanhamento = db.ControleAcompanhamento.Find(id); db.ControleAcompanhamento.Remove(controleAcompanhamento); db.SaveChanges(); return(RedirectToAction("Index")); }
public ActionResult Edit([Bind(Include = "Id,Codigo,Data_Cadastro,descricao,status")] ControleAcompanhamento controleAcompanhamento) { if (ModelState.IsValid) { db.Entry(controleAcompanhamento).State = Microsoft.EntityFrameworkCore.EntityState.Modified; db.SaveChanges(); return(RedirectToAction("Index")); } return(View(controleAcompanhamento)); }
public ActionResult Create([Bind(Include = "Id,Codigo,Data_Cadastro,descricao,status")] ControleAcompanhamento controleAcompanhamento) { if (ModelState.IsValid) { db.ControleAcompanhamento.Add(controleAcompanhamento); db.SaveChanges(); return(RedirectToAction("Index")); } return(View(controleAcompanhamento)); }
// GET: ControleAcompanhamentoes/Delete/5 public ActionResult Delete(int?id) { if (id == null) { return(new HttpStatusCodeResult(HttpStatusCode.BadRequest)); } ControleAcompanhamento controleAcompanhamento = db.ControleAcompanhamento.Find(id); if (controleAcompanhamento == null) { return(HttpNotFound()); } return(View(controleAcompanhamento)); }
public JsonResult Salvar(string pessoa_Id, string data_cadastro, string avaliacao, string descricao) { ControleAcompanhamento acompanhamento = new ControleAcompanhamento(); acompanhamento.Codigo = ObterProximoCodigo(); acompanhamento.Data_Cadastro = new DateTime(); acompanhamento.Pessoa_Id = db.Pessoa.Find(Convert.ToInt32(pessoa_Id)); acompanhamento.status = avaliacao; acompanhamento.descricao = descricao; db.ControleAcompanhamento.Add(acompanhamento); db.SaveChanges(); return(Json(db.ControleAcompanhamento.Where(d => d.Codigo > 0).Include(d => d.Pessoa_Id).ToList(), JsonRequestBehavior.AllowGet)); }